Red Cross Message from Mrs Madeline Curtis [Madeleine Marie Curtis, née Collin] in Poole to her sister Mrs Henriette Blampied [Henriette Marie Blampied, née Collin] of Bulwarks, St Aubin. Includes reply on the reverse.
Reference | L/C/234/A1/1 |
Date | 27 December 1940 - 18 April 1941 |
Scope and Content | Message from Madeleine refers to Geoff [Geoffrey Curtis]. Reply from Henriette mentions the birth of Desmond Colin [Desmond Colin Blampied] on 11 November [1940] and refers to Roselle [Roselle May Blampied] and Sally [Sally Ann Curtis]. |
